This lecture introduces text classification and the Naive Bayes algorithm, a key method for text classification. Examples of text classification applications are discussed, such as identifying spam emails. Features that may indicate an email is spam include typos, unusual wording like "important notice", lack of personalization, undisclosed recipients, and suspicious URLs. These features can be combined to determine if an email is spam.
